Worked Solution:
On the
Argand diagram, the modulus of the complex number
z is
the distance of the point
(x, y) = (Re(z), Im(z)) from the origin:
|z| = √(x2 + y2) = &radic( 82 + 42) = 8.944 to 3 dps.
The argument is the angle
θ that a line from the origin to the same point makes with the (positive)
x-axis:
the principal argument is the same angle but in the range -Pi to Pi radians (-180° to 180°)
x > 0 and
y > 0 
the point is in the 1
st quadrant (0° to 90°):
tan(θ) = | y |  | x |
| = | 4 |  | 8 |
| = 0.50000 |
θ = 0.464 radians = 26.565° to 3 dps.
